Get Rich Slowly in the UK: A Guide to Building Wealth Over Time
Building wealth is a goal for many people, and while there are various paths to financial success, one approach that has proven to be effective for many is the concept of getting rich slowly. This approach emphasises patience, discipline, and a long-term mindset, as it involves making smart financial decisions over time to steadily grow wealth. In the UK, where the economy and financial landscape may differ from other countries, there are specific considerations to keep in mind when aiming to get rich slowly. In this article, we will explore the principles and strategies for building wealth gradually in the UK.
Understanding the Concept of Getting Rich Slowly
Getting rich slowly is a financial philosophy that advocates for taking a patient and disciplined approach to wealth-building. It involves making prudent financial decisions, saving and investing wisely, and being consistent over time. The idea is to avoid get-rich-quick schemes or taking unnecessary risks that could lead to financial setbacks. Instead, the focus is on steady progress, building wealth slowly but surely, and allowing compound interest to work its magic over the long term.
In the context of the UK, getting rich slowly may be particularly relevant due to the unique economic and financial landscape. The UK has a diverse economy with opportunities in various sectors, but it also has its challenges, such as high living costs in certain areas, fluctuating property markets, and evolving retirement provisions. Therefore, it’s important to have a clear understanding of the UK-specific considerations when adopting a get-rich-slowly approach.
Principles of Getting Rich Slowly in the UK
To successfully get rich slowly in the UK, it’s important to follow certain principles that can help guide your financial decisions and actions. These principles are based on long-term thinking, smart money management, and disciplined saving and investing. Let’s explore them in detail.
Set Clear Financial Goals: One of the first steps in getting rich slowly is to set clear financial goals. This involves defining what you want to achieve financially, both in the short-term and the long-term. For example, you may have goals such as saving for a down payment on a house, building an emergency fund, investing for retirement, or starting a business. Setting clear financial goals helps you stay focused and motivated, and it provides a roadmap for your financial journey.
Create a Budget and Stick to It: Budgeting is a fundamental aspect of effective money management. Creating a budget involves tracking your income and expenses, and allocating your money to different categories, such as savings, investments, bills, and discretionary spending. A budget helps you understand where your money is going, identify areas where you can cut expenses, and ensure that you are saving and investing consistently. It’s important to stick to your budget and avoid unnecessary spending that can hinder your progress towards your financial goals.
Save and Invest Wisely: Saving and investing are critical components of getting rich slowly. Saving involves setting aside a portion of your income for emergencies, short-term goals, and long-term goals. It’s important to establish an emergency fund that can cover at least three to six months of living expenses, as unexpected financial challenges can arise at any time. In addition to saving, investing is key to building wealth over time. Investing allows your money to grow through the power of compound interest, which can significantly increase your wealth over the long term. It’s important to invest wisely, considering factors such as risk tolerance, time horizon, and diversification to create a balanced investment portfolio that aligns with your financial goals.
Pay Off Debts Strategically: Managing debts is an essential aspect of building wealth. If you have debts, such as credit card debt, student loans, or a mortgage, it’s important to have a strategic plan to pay them off.
Paying off debts strategically involves prioritising high-interest debts, such as credit card debts, and paying them off as soon as possible. You can also consider consolidating debts or refinancing to lower interest rates and reduce monthly payments. Avoid taking on unnecessary debts and be mindful of your borrowing habits to ensure that debts do not hinder your progress towards building wealth over time.
Diversify Your Investments: Diversification is a key principle of investing for wealth-building. It involves spreading your investments across different asset classes, sectors, and regions to reduce risk and increase potential returns. Diversification helps to minimise the impact of market fluctuations and provides a balanced approach to investing. Consider investing in a mix of stocks, bonds, real estate, and other investment options that align with your risk tolerance and financial goals. It’s important to regularly review and rebalance your investment portfolio to ensure that it remains diversified and aligned with your long-term objectives.
Be Mindful of Taxes: Taxes can have a significant impact on your wealth-building journey. In the UK, the tax system can be complex and it’s important to be aware of the different types of taxes, such as income tax, capital gains tax, and inheritance tax, and how they may affect your investments and financial decisions. Consider working with a qualified tax professional or financial advisor to optimise your tax strategies and minimise your tax liabilities legally and ethically.
Continuously Educate Yourself: Building wealth requires financial literacy and knowledge. Continuously educate yourself about personal finance, investing, and other relevant topics. Stay informed about changes in the economic and financial landscape in the UK and how they may impact your wealth-building strategies. There are numerous resources available, such as books, websites, seminars, and podcasts, that can provide valuable information and insights to help you make informed financial decisions.
Practice Patience and Discipline: Getting rich slowly requires patience and discipline. It’s important to stay committed to your financial goals and stick to your long-term strategies, even during challenging times. Avoid making impulsive financial decisions based on short-term market fluctuations or external pressures. Remember that wealth-building is a marathon, not a sprint, and it requires consistent efforts over time.
Strategies for Getting Rich Slowly in the UK
In addition to the principles mentioned above, there are specific strategies that can help you get rich slowly in the UK. Let’s explore some of them in detail.
Prioritise Retirement Savings: Saving for retirement is a crucial aspect of building wealth in the UK. The UK has a pension system that provides a state pension, but it may not be sufficient to cover your retirement expenses. Therefore, it’s important to prioritise retirement savings and take advantage of pension plans, such as workplace pensions or personal pensions. These plans typically offer tax benefits, such as tax relief on contributions and tax-deferred growth, which can significantly boost your retirement savings. Start saving for retirement as early as possible and consistently contribute to your pension plan to take advantage of compounding over time.
Invest in Tax-Efficient Options: In the UK, there are tax-efficient investment options, such as Individual Savings Accounts (ISAs) and Self-Invested Personal Pensions (SIPPs), that can help you build wealth more efficiently. ISAs are savings and investment accounts that allow you to invest up to a certain amount each year tax-free, and any gains or income generated from the investments within the ISA are also tax-free. SIPPs are personal pensions that offer tax benefits similar to workplace pensions, such as tax relief on contributions and tax-deferred growth. Consider investing in these tax-efficient options to optimize your wealth-building strategies and minimise your tax liabilities.
Consider Property Investment: Property investment can be a viable strategy for building wealth in the UK, given the historical appreciation of property prices in many parts of the country. Owning property can provide multiple avenues for wealth creation, such as rental income, capital appreciation, and potential tax benefits. However, property investment also comes with risks, such as market fluctuations, property management challenges, and financing costs. It’s essential to thoroughly research and understand the property market, evaluate the potential returns and risks, and seek professional advice before venturing into property investment.
Build a Diverse Portfolio of Investments: Along with tax-efficient options and property investment, it’s important to build a diverse portfolio of investments to spread risk and increase potential returns. Consider investing in a mix of asset classes, such as stocks, bonds, real estate, and alternative investments, based on your risk tolerance and financial goals. Diversification helps to mitigate the impact of market fluctuations and provides a balanced approach to investing. Regularly review and rebalance your investment portfolio to ensure that it remains diversified and aligned with your long-term objectives.
Maximise Earnings Potential: Another effective strategy for building wealth in the UK is to maximise your earnings potential. This can involve advancing your career, acquiring new skills or certifications, negotiating for higher pay or benefits, and seeking additional sources of income, such as part-time jobs, freelance work, or side businesses. Increasing your earnings can provide more resources to save, invest, and build wealth over time. It’s important to continually invest in your professional development and be proactive in seeking opportunities to increase your income.
Control Expenses and Practice Frugality: Controlling expenses and practicing frugality is a crucial aspect of wealth-building. It’s important to live within your means, avoid unnecessary expenses, and be mindful of your spending habits. Review your monthly expenses, identify areas where you can cut costs, and prioritise saving and investing over excessive spending. Practice frugality by making conscious choices about your spending, such as buying used items, cooking at home, and avoiding unnecessary debts. Saving and investing the money you would have otherwise spent can significantly accelerate your wealth-building journey.
Protect Your Assets and Manage Risks: Protecting your assets and managing risks is an important part of wealth-building. It’s essential to have adequate insurance coverage, such as health insurance, home insurance, and life insurance, to protect yourself and your assets from unforeseen events. Additionally, consider building an emergency fund that can cover 3-6 months of living expenses to provide a financial buffer in case of unexpected emergencies or job loss. Managing risks also involves being cautious about potential investment risks, such as market fluctuations, inflation, and geopolitical events. Diversification, as mentioned earlier, can be a strategy to manage investment risks.
Seek Professional Advice: Building wealth in the UK can be complex, and it’s important to seek professional advice when needed. Consider working with a qualified financial advisor, tax professional, or estate planner to optimise your wealth-building strategies, create a comprehensive financial plan, and ensure that you are on track to achieve your financial goals. A professional can provide valuable insights, expertise, and guidance to help you make informed financial decisions and navigate the complexities of the UK financial landscape.

Create a daily plan to meditate more easily with our step by step guide
Here is a step-by-step guide to create a daily meditation plan:
Determine the time and place: Choose a time and place where you won’t be disturbed, such as first thing in the morning or just before bedtime. Also, find a quiet, comfortable spot where you can sit or lie down and relax.
Set a goal: Determine how long you want to meditate each day, whether it’s 5 minutes, 10 minutes or 20 minutes. Start with a manageable goal and gradually increase the time as you get more comfortable with the practice.
Get comfortable: Find a comfortable seated position, either on a chair or cushion on the floor. You can also lie down, but be sure to stay awake. Keep your back straight and relax your muscles.
Focus on your breath: Close your eyes and take a few deep breaths. Then, begin to focus on your breath and the sensation of the air moving in and out of your body. If your mind starts to wander, simply bring your attention back to your breath.
Use a mantra or visualisation: Repeat a mantra or visualisation to help you focus and calm your mind. For example, you can visualize a peaceful scene or repeat the words “peace” or “calm”.
End your meditation: When your timer goes off, take a few deep breaths and slowly open your eyes. Take a moment to stretch and shake out any tension.
Make it a daily habit: Make meditation a part of your daily routine by setting aside the same time and place each day. You can also use a reminder or an app to help you stay on track.
Remember that meditation is a practice and it takes time to develop. Be patient and kind to yourself, and eventually you will find it easier to quiet your mind and find peace through meditation.

10 healthy eating tips
Eating a healthy diet is an important part of maintaining overall health and well-being. Here are 10 tips for healthy eating:
Focus on whole, unprocessed foods. These types of foods are typically more nutritious and contain fewer additives and preservatives. Examples include fruits, vegetables, whole grains, legumes, nuts, and seeds.
Eat a variety of foods. No single food provides all the nutrients your body needs. By eating a variety of foods, you’ll ensure that you’re getting a wide range of nutrients.
Incorporate plant-based protein sources. Beans, lentils, tofu, and other plant-based protein sources are not only nutritious but also generally lower in saturated fat and calories compared to animal-based protein sources.
Limit added sugars and salt. Added sugars and salt can contribute to health problems such as obesity, high blood pressure, and tooth decay. Look for foods that are lower in added sugars and salt and try to use them sparingly when cooking at home.
Choose healthy fats. Some fats, such as olive oil, avocado, and nuts, can be a healthy part of your diet. However, it’s important to limit your intake of saturated and trans fats, which can increase your risk of heart disease.
Eat plenty of fruits and vegetables. These foods are high in fiber, vitamins, and minerals, and they can help you feel full while keeping your calorie intake in check. Aim for at least five servings of fruits and vegetables per day.
Drink plenty of water. Water is essential for maintaining hydration and supporting various bodily functions. Aim to drink at least 8 cups (64 ounces) of water per day.
Control portion sizes. Eating larger portions than your body needs can contribute to weight gain. Be mindful of portion sizes and aim to eat appropriate amounts for your energy needs.
Plan ahead. Taking the time to plan and prepare your meals can help you make healthier choices and avoid last-minute decisions that may not be as nutritious.
Don’t skip meals. Skipping meals can lead to overeating later on and may disrupt your body’s natural hunger and fullness cues. It’s important to eat regular, balanced meals to support overall health and well-being.
By following these tips, you can improve your eating habits and adopt a healthier diet that supports your overall health and well-being.
